Overview

Established in 1994, this craft brewery in Kailua-Kona, Hawaii, was founded by Cameron Healy and Spoon Khalsa with the mission of capturing the essence of Hawaii through a distinct range of beers. Starting out in a repurposed newspaper pressroom, the brewery has expanded to become a globally recognized craft beer brand known for innovation, sustainability, and engagement with the local community.

The brewery offers approximately 10 regular beer styles, including favorites such as Big Wave, Pipeline Porter, and Rift Zone Indigenous Red Ale, all crafted with locally sourced Hawaiian ingredients. Its flagship brewpubs in Kailua-Kona and Hawai‘i Kai invite visitors to enjoy fresh beers on-site. A dedication to environmentally responsible practices and community outreach underscores its ongoing support for Hawaiian culture and the island environment.
